Iran-Iraq quake toll passes 400 | Bangkok Post: news


Survivors sit in front of buildings damaged by an earthquake, in Sarpol-e-Zahab, western Iran, Monday. Sunday night's magnitude 7.3 earthquake struck about 30 kilometre outside the eastern Iraqi city of Halabja, according to the most recent measurements from the US Geological Survey (USGS). Residents fled into the streets as the quake struck, without time to grab their possessions, as apartment complexes collapsed into rubble. Outside walls of some complexes were sheared off by the quake, power and water lines were severed, and telephone service was disrupted. Firefighters from Tehran joined other rescuers in the desperate search, using dogs to inspect the rubble.
